The Connecticut legal … shank thicknessWebWhat is the Notice of Intent form? It is a document that was developed in 1990 by the CT State Board of Education. It was a compromise document that resulted from a meeting between the SBOE and a group of home educators. The SBOE wanted some type of required procedure and the homeschool parents did not.
